summ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Adam T. Carpenter <atc@53hor.net>2024-01-25 09:53:59 -0500
committerAdam T. Carpenter <atc@53hor.net>2024-01-25 09:53:59 -0500
commit2ae09557fc81d668c70620ace7e2ee0670f97cef (patch)
treee26d05904b2c258f7304054d4fe1bea7fbdf77b0
parent7ae706778ea86251f3711b5defa83e975dc6be81 (diff)
downloaddotfiles-2ae09557fc81d668c70620ace7e2ee0670f97cef.tar.xz
dotfiles-2ae09557fc81d668c70620ace7e2ee0670f97cef.zip
pre-upgrade
-rw-r--r--.config/gtk-3.0/settings.ini3
-rw-r--r--.config/rofi/config.rasi8
-rw-r--r--.config/sway/config142
-rw-r--r--.vim/spell/en.utf-8.add4
-rw-r--r--.vim/spell/en.utf-8.add.splbin556 -> 633 bytes
-rw-r--r--.zprofile2
6 files changed, 84 insertions, 75 deletions
diff --git a/.config/gtk-3.0/settings.ini b/.config/gtk-3.0/settings.ini
deleted file mode 100644
index a640e84..0000000
--- a/.config/gtk-3.0/settings.ini
+++ /dev/null
@@ -1,3 +0,0 @@
-[Settings]
-gtk-theme-name=FlatColor
-
diff --git a/.config/rofi/config.rasi b/.config/rofi/config.rasi
index 4d0eb3d..90b89fc 100644
--- a/.config/rofi/config.rasi
+++ b/.config/rofi/config.rasi
@@ -1,12 +1,14 @@
@theme "wpg"
configuration {
- modi: "combi,filebrowser,emoji";
+ modi: "combi";
+ combi-modi: "run,ssh,emoji,pass:rofi-pass.sh pass,otp:rofi-pass.sh otp";
+ show-icons: true;
+ sidebar-mode: true;
/* font: "mono 12";*/
/* location: 0;*/
/* yoffset: 0;*/
/* xoffset: 0;*/
/* fixed-num-lines: true;*/
- show-icons: true;
/* terminal: "rofi-sensible-terminal";*/
/* ssh-client: "ssh";*/
/* ssh-command: "{terminal} -e {ssh-client} {host} [-p {port}]";*/
@@ -27,13 +29,11 @@ configuration {
/* sorting-method: "normal";*/
/* case-sensitive: false;*/
/* cycle: true;*/
- sidebar-mode: true;
/* hover-select: false;*/
/* eh: 1;*/
/* auto-select: false;*/
/* parse-hosts: false;*/
/* parse-known-hosts: true;*/
- combi-modi: "run,ssh";
/* matching: "normal";*/
/* tokenize: true;*/
/* m: "-5";*/
diff --git a/.config/sway/config b/.config/sway/config
index ccb6f0b..4d20af6 100644
--- a/.config/sway/config
+++ b/.config/sway/config
@@ -42,30 +42,31 @@ workspace $ws9 output primary
workspace $ws10 output primary
# switch to workspace
-bindsym Mod1+1 workspace $ws1
-bindsym Mod1+2 workspace $ws2
-bindsym Mod1+3 workspace $ws3
-bindsym Mod1+4 workspace $ws4
-bindsym Mod1+5 workspace $ws5
-bindsym Mod1+6 workspace $ws6
-bindsym Mod1+7 workspace $ws7
-bindsym Mod1+8 workspace $ws8
-bindsym Mod1+9 workspace $ws9
-bindsym Mod1+0 workspace $ws10
-bindsym Mod1+Tab workspace back_and_forth
-bindsym Mod1+Shift+Tab exec rofi -show window
+bindsym Mod4+1 workspace $ws1
+bindsym Mod4+2 workspace $ws2
+bindsym Mod4+3 workspace $ws3
+bindsym Mod4+4 workspace $ws4
+bindsym Mod4+5 workspace $ws5
+bindsym Mod4+6 workspace $ws6
+bindsym Mod4+7 workspace $ws7
+bindsym Mod4+8 workspace $ws8
+bindsym Mod4+9 workspace $ws9
+bindsym Mod4+0 workspace $ws10
+bindsym Mod4+Tab workspace next_on_output
+bindsym Mod4+Shift+Tab workspace prev_on_output
+workspace_auto_back_and_forth yes
# move focused container to workspace
-bindsym Mod1+shift+1 move container to workspace $ws1
-bindsym Mod1+shift+2 move container to workspace $ws2
-bindsym Mod1+shift+3 move container to workspace $ws3
-bindsym Mod1+shift+4 move container to workspace $ws4
-bindsym Mod1+shift+5 move container to workspace $ws5
-bindsym Mod1+shift+6 move container to workspace $ws6
-bindsym Mod1+shift+7 move container to workspace $ws7
-bindsym Mod1+shift+8 move container to workspace $ws8
-bindsym Mod1+shift+9 move container to workspace $ws9
-bindsym Mod1+shift+0 move container to workspace $ws10
+bindsym Mod4+shift+1 move container to workspace $ws1
+bindsym Mod4+shift+2 move container to workspace $ws2
+bindsym Mod4+shift+3 move container to workspace $ws3
+bindsym Mod4+shift+4 move container to workspace $ws4
+bindsym Mod4+shift+5 move container to workspace $ws5
+bindsym Mod4+shift+6 move container to workspace $ws6
+bindsym Mod4+shift+7 move container to workspace $ws7
+bindsym Mod4+shift+8 move container to workspace $ws8
+bindsym Mod4+shift+9 move container to workspace $ws9
+bindsym Mod4+shift+0 move container to workspace $ws10
# move workspaces between outputs on dock
bindswitch --reload --locked lid:on output eDP-1 disable ; output DP-3 enable;
@@ -76,9 +77,9 @@ bindswitch --reload --locked lid:off output eDP-1 enable ; output DP-3 disable;
default_border pixel
hide_edge_borders smart
title_align center
-floating_modifier Mod1
-bindsym Mod1+shift+p move scratchpad
-bindsym Mod1+p scratchpad show
+floating_modifier Mod4
+bindsym Mod4+shift+p move scratchpad
+bindsym Mod4+p scratchpad show
# movement
set $down j
@@ -87,65 +88,62 @@ set $right l
set $up k
# change focus
-bindsym Mod1+$down focus down
-bindsym Mod1+$left focus left
-bindsym Mod1+$right focus right
-bindsym Mod1+$up focus up
-bindsym Mod1+space focus mode_toggle
+bindsym Mod4+$down focus down
+bindsym Mod4+$left focus left
+bindsym Mod4+$right focus right
+bindsym Mod4+$up focus up
# move focused window
-bindsym Mod1+shift+$down move down
-bindsym Mod1+shift+$left move left
-bindsym Mod1+shift+$right move right
-bindsym Mod1+shift+$up move up
+bindsym Mod4+shift+$down move down
+bindsym Mod4+shift+$left move left
+bindsym Mod4+shift+$right move right
+bindsym Mod4+shift+$up move up
# resize
-bindsym Mod1+i resize grow height
-bindsym Mod1+o resize grow width
-bindsym Mod1+u resize shrink height
-bindsym Mod1+y resize shrink width
+bindsym Mod4+i resize grow height
+bindsym Mod4+o resize grow width
+bindsym Mod4+u resize shrink height
+bindsym Mod4+y resize shrink width
## LAYOUT
-bindsym Mod1+f fullscreen toggle
-bindsym Mod1+shift+space floating toggle
-bindsym Mod1+shift+s floating enable; sticky toggle
+bindsym Mod4+f fullscreen toggle
+bindsym Mod4+shift+space floating toggle
+bindsym Mod4+shift+s floating enable; sticky toggle
## CONTROLS
-bindsym Mod1+shift+q kill
-bindsym Mod1+shift+e exit
-bindsym Mod1+shift+c reload
-#bindsym Mod1+shift+r restart
+bindsym Mod4+q kill
+bindsym Mod4+shift+r reload
## SHORTCUTS
-bindsym Mod1+Return split horizontal; exec $term
-bindsym Mod1+shift+Return split vertical; exec $term
-bindsym Mod1+control+Return split horizontal; exec $term -e mosh dev.53hor.net
-bindsym Mod1+control+shift+Return split vertical; exec $term -e mosh dev.53hor.net
+bindsym Mod4+Return split horizontal; exec $term
+bindsym Mod4+shift+Return split vertical; exec $term
+bindsym Mod4+control+Return split horizontal; exec $term -e mosh dev.53hor.net
+bindsym Mod4+control+shift+Return split vertical; exec $term -e mosh dev.53hor.net
#bindsym Mod4+p exec arandr
#bindsym Mod4+l exec xautolock -locknow
-bindsym Mod1+F1 exec rofi -show combi
-bindsym Mod1+F2 workspace $ws1 ; exec firefox
-bindsym Mod1+F3 exec exec thunderbird
-bindsym Mod1+F4 exec passmenu.sh
-#bindsym Mod1+F5 exec
-#bindsym Mod1+F1 exec
-#bindsym Mod1+F1 exec
-#bindsym Mod1+F1 exec
-#bindsym Mod1+F6 exec
-#bindsym Mod1+F7 exec
-#bindsym Mod1+F8 exec
-#bindsym Mod1+F9 exec passmenu.sh
-bindsym Mod1+F10 exec mixer vol -5 && $sigaudio
-bindsym Mod1+F11 exec mixer vol +5 && $sigaudio
-bindsym Mod1+F12 exec mixer vol 0 && $sigaudio
+bindsym Mod4+space exec rofi -show combi
+bindsym Mod4+F2 workspace $ws1 ; exec firefox
+bindsym Mod4+F3 exec thunderbird
+#bindsym Mod4+F4 exec passmenu.sh
+#bindsym Mod4+F5 exec
+#bindsym Mod4+F1 exec
+#bindsym Mod4+F1 exec
+#bindsym Mod4+F1 exec
+#bindsym Mod4+F6 exec
+#bindsym Mod4+F7 exec
+#bindsym Mod4+F8 exec
+#bindsym Mod4+F9 exec passmenu.sh
+bindsym Mod4+F10 exec mixer vol 0 && $sigaudio
+bindsym Mod4+F11 exec mixer vol -5 && $sigaudio
+bindsym Mod4+F12 exec mixer vol +5 && $sigaudio
bindsym XF86AudioLowerVolume exec mixer vol -5 && $sigaudio
bindsym XF86AudioRaiseVolume exec mixer vol +5 && $sigaudio
bindsym XF86AudioMute exec mixer vol 0 && $sigaudio
bindsym --release Print exec grim
-bindsym Mod1+Pause exec swaylock ; exec doas acpiconf -s3
+bindsym Mod4+Pause exec swaylock ; exec doas acpiconf -s3
## COLORS
@@ -171,12 +169,21 @@ mode $mode_record {
}
set $mode_modes "󱊷 default 󱊫 recording"
-bindsym Mod1+Escape mode $mode_modes
+bindsym Mod4+Escape mode $mode_modes
mode $mode_modes {
bindsym Escape mode default
bindsym F1 mode $mode_record
}
+set $mode_quit "Really quit? (y/N)"
+mode $mode_quit {
+ bindsym y exit
+ bindsym Return mode default
+ bindsym n mode default
+ bindsym Escape mode default
+}
+bindsym Mod4+shift+q mode $mode_quit
+
## ASSIGNMENTS
assign [class="Firefox"] $ws1
@@ -185,4 +192,5 @@ for_window [class="pwcview"] floating enable ; sticky enable
for_window [title="wpgtk*"] floating enable
## STARTUP
-exec_always sh /home/atc/.config/wpg/wp-init.sh
+exec_always ~/.config/wpg/wp_init.sh
+exec swayidle -w timeout 300 'swaymsg "output * dpms off"' resume 'swaymsg "output * dpms on"'
diff --git a/.vim/spell/en.utf-8.add b/.vim/spell/en.utf-8.add
index c0abba3..da8bfd1 100644
--- a/.vim/spell/en.utf-8.add
+++ b/.vim/spell/en.utf-8.add
@@ -33,3 +33,7 @@ Squarespace
carpentertutoring
Quickstart
Whitespace
+workstream
+Kubernetes
+MySQL
+Symfony
diff --git a/.vim/spell/en.utf-8.add.spl b/.vim/spell/en.utf-8.add.spl
index ac78f0b..072f851 100644
--- a/.vim/spell/en.utf-8.add.spl
+++ b/.vim/spell/en.utf-8.add.spl
Binary files differ
diff --git a/.zprofile b/.zprofile
index 4542f8f..05be15f 100644
--- a/.zprofile
+++ b/.zprofile
@@ -3,4 +3,4 @@ export XDG_RUNTIME_DIR=/var/run/user/`id -u` \
MOZ_ENABLE_WAYLAND=1 \
GDK_BACKEND=wayland \
MOZ_DBUS_REMOTE=1
-[ -z $DISPLAY ] && [ $(tty) = /dev/ttyv0 ] && exec sway > /var/log/sway.log
+#[ -z $DISPLAY ] && [ $(tty) = /dev/ttyv0 ] && exec sway > /var/log/sway.log